RUNBOOK: SDK parity checks (Fernhollow platform). Two client SDKs ship against the sync API: the legacy JS SDK and the new Swift SDK. They must stay feature-equivalent — same endpoints, same retry semantics, same pagination caps. Before merging any API change, run the parity harness; it diffs both SDKs against the spec and fails on any gap. If the harness flags drift, do not ship; escalate to the platform channel. The harness reads its targets from the config below.

config for bagep-kageg:
ULADOR_LOG_LEVEL=warn
ULADOR_METRICS_HOST=metrics.ulador.tolvaqcorp.corp
ULADOR_POOL_SIZE=32

This PR adjusts the driver-assignment heuristic in DispatchMate so that long-idle drivers near the Harlow depot are no longer starved by proximity scoring. Support should see fewer "why was I skipped" tickets. Behavior is identical except when idle time exceeds the decay window. The heuristic is governed by the following tuning constants.

tuning constants:
QUOTAS = {
    "julwyn": 448,
    "belix": 11,
}

### Checklist: Ship `tailhawk` v0.9

Before tagging the release of tailhawk, our internal log-tailing CLI, confirm the follow-mode reconnect logic survives a broker restart without duplicating lines. Run the soak script against the Brindlemoor staging cluster for at least thirty minutes and inspect the dedupe counters. Document any flag changes in the man page, since downstream scripts at the Ferrowell team parse `--help` output. Once verified, record the build token directly beneath this item.

build token for kagaf-hahof: htk14_9d3d4d26d7d8de

### Key Ceremony Checklist — Item 7: Cron Drift Investigation (Tindervale Scheduler)

Before sealing keys, confirm the drift probe on the Tindervale scheduler shows under 30s skew across all nodes. If skew exceeds threshold, halt ceremony, capture `crond --audit` output, and escalate to on-call. Do not re-sign schedules while drift is unresolved. Document skew values in the ceremony log. Access to the drift probe's sealed config requires the recovery passphrase below.

unlock words, kawip-hadup: tamath-wenir-sorius-sorius-wenix-novvan-istox-wenius-feneth-briiel